How You’ll Make an Impact
Support the orthodontist in delivering exceptional patient care throughout all stages of treatment
Perform orthodontic procedures including bracket bonding, banding, debonding, and arch wire changes
Insert, cement, and remove fixed and removable orthodontic appliances
Deliver clear aligners, perform attachment placement and removal, and monitor patient progress
Take high quality records including digital scans, photos, and radiographs
Provide personalized oral hygiene instructions and coach patients on elastics, appliance care, and compliance
Educate patients and parents on treatment expectations, timelines, and progress
Accurately chart procedures and maintain thorough clinical documentation
Collaborate with the team to support smooth clinic flow and an excellent patient experience
